什么是DDNS?
动态域名系统(Dynamic Domain Name System,简称DDNS)是一种将动态IP地址映射到固定域名的技术。它使得用户在使用动态IP地址的情况下,仍然能够通过一个固定的域名访问网络资源。DDNS在科学上网中扮演着重要的角色,尤其是在需要远程访问和网络安全的场景中。
DDNS的工作原理
DDNS的工作原理主要包括以下几个步骤:
- 动态IP地址获取:用户的网络服务提供商(ISP)会定期分配动态IP地址给用户。
- DDNS客户端:用户在本地网络中安装DDNS客户端软件,该软件会定期向DDNS服务提供商发送当前的IP地址。
- 更新域名记录:DDNS服务提供商接收到IP地址后,会自动更新与该IP地址关联的域名记录。
- 域名解析:当用户通过域名访问时,DNS服务器会将域名解析为最新的IP地址,从而实现访问。
DDNS在科学上网中的应用
1. 远程访问
使用DDNS,用户可以方便地远程访问家庭或公司网络中的设备,如监控摄像头、NAS存储等。通过固定的域名,用户无需记住不断变化的IP地址。
2. 提高网络安全
DDNS可以与VPN结合使用,增强网络安全性。用户可以通过VPN连接到远程网络,确保数据传输的安全性。
3. 解决网络限制
在某些地区,访问特定网站可能会受到限制。通过使用DDNS,用户可以轻松切换到不同的服务器,从而绕过这些限制。
如何配置DDNS
1. 选择DDNS服务提供商
选择一个可靠的DDNS服务提供商是配置的第一步。常见的DDNS服务提供商包括:
- No-IP
- DynDNS
- DuckDNS
2. 注册账户
在选择的DDNS服务提供商网站上注册一个账户,并创建一个域名。
3. 安装DDNS客户端
根据提供商的说明,下载并安装DDNS客户端。配置客户端以便它能够定期更新IP地址。
4. 路由器设置
在路由器中配置DDNS设置,输入提供商的相关信息,包括用户名、密码和域名。
5. 测试连接
完成配置后,使用域名测试连接是否成功。如果一切正常,用户就可以通过域名访问网络资源了。
常见问题解答(FAQ)
Q1: DDNS和静态IP有什么区别?
DDNS是为动态IP地址设计的,而静态IP是固定不变的。使用DDNS可以节省成本,因为静态IP通常需要额外付费。
Q2: 如何选择合适的DDNS服务提供商?
选择DDNS服务提供商时,可以考虑以下因素:
- 服务的稳定性
- 客户支持
- 价格
- 提供的功能(如API支持、更新频率等)
Q3: DDNS是否安全?
虽然DDNS本身并不提供加密,但可以与VPN结合使用,从而提高安全性。确保使用强密码和定期更新密码也是保护账户安全的重要措施。
Q4: DDNS更新频率如何设置?
更新频率通常可以在DDNS客户端中设置。建议设置为每5-10分钟更新一次,以确保域名记录的及时性。
Q5: 如果我的IP地址没有变化,DDNS会更新吗?
如果IP地址没有变化,DDNS客户端通常不会进行更新。这是为了减少不必要的网络流量和负担。
结论
DDNS在科学上网中具有重要的应用价值。通过合理配置DDNS,用户可以实现远程